DEVICE AND METHOD FOR MEASURING VELOCITY OF MOVING BODY WITH HIGH ACCURACY

机译:一种高精度的运动体速度测量装置及方法

摘要

PROBLEM TO BE SOLVED: To provide a device and a method for determining the quality of Doppler velocity information obtained from a GPS receiver and for outputting velocity in real time with high accuracy and high reliability.;SOLUTION: The device 10 for measuring the velocity of a moving body with high accuracy calculates the velocity of a moving body from the acceleration and angular velocity of the moving body by using strap down calculation, measures Doppler velocity of the moving body from the Doppler shift amount of a GPS carrier wave, and calculates a quality coefficient from the Doppler velocity. Then, the device 10 synchronizes delayed Doppler velocity with fed back real-time interpolation velocity, calculates the error amount between the synchronized Doppler velocity and the real-time interpolation velocity, multiplies the calculated error amount by the quality coefficient, and from the error amount multiplied by the quality coefficient, estimates and calculates the adjustment amount to the real-time interpolation velocity by a Kalman filter. The velocity calculated by using the strap down calculation is merged with the adjustment amount estimated and calculated by the Kalman filter, and the real-time interpolation velocity is calculated and output.;COPYRIGHT: (C)2012,JPO&INPIT
机译:解决的问题:提供一种确定从GPS接收器获得的多普勒速度信息的质量并以高精度和高可靠性实时输出速度的装置和方法。解决方案:用于测量速度的装置10高精度的移动体通过使用束带向下计算从移动体的加速度和角速度计算出移动体的速度,从GPS载波的多普勒频移量测量移动体的多普勒速度,并计算出多普勒速度的质量系数。然后,设备10将延迟的多普勒速度与反馈的实时内插速度同步,计算同步的多普勒速度和实时内插速度之间的误差量,将计算出的误差量乘以质量系数,并从误差量中求出。乘以质量系数,通过卡尔曼滤波器估算并计算对实时插值速度的调整量。使用束带下降计算法计算出的速度与卡尔曼滤波器估算并计算出的调整量合并,然后计算并输出实时插补速度。;版权所有:(C)2012,JPO&INPIT
